Pros

Retail discount There is now a movement to support women in tech. But not all teams across the company recognize it. Case in point, there are teams in which female engineers are the second class.

Cons

Inconsistency across multiple teams. It is really depending on the group and your manager. The company sells a lot products to women, and yet it was tolerated to yell, to call name to a female engineer. A female engineer was forced to write letter of resignation or else her working day would be made sure horrible for her. She was lied to, she was told, if she wrote a letter of resignation, her manager would put in a good word for her record, instead he did none of that. She was used as blaming point for all issues. Work /life balance is 3 stars because it is very inconsistent across teams, there are teams, where managers allow some wfh, while other managers sent out email to prohibit employees to wfh.

Pros

Decent base pay, somewhat autonomous, great tip potential.

Cons

The company has changed for the worse since COVID. When I came back the mood of the entire store had shifted. Gone were the days of comradery, customer focus, and taking pride in a job well done. In its place there is a new culture of cutthroat sales, a severe decline in customer focus, and worst of all a new focus on profit over customer satisfaction. When I was told that the amount the store charged for a shoe shine was not enough to do the best job I could for a customer I knew things had gone downhill for the company. Not to mention I watch a manager prey on a mentally disabled person in order to secure a sale, when the person could not understand what was being offered. Sad that such a once great company is now just another greed ridden corporation.
